Jagran correspondent, Noida. The election bugle of Noida Entrepreneurs Association (NEA), the oldest industrial organization in the industrial city, has sounded. The day of election voting has been fixed for 17th January. On Thursday, election officials finalized the voter list and pasted it on the NEA building.
Election officer Rakesh Katyal said that till December 31, the membership renewal process for entrepreneurs to participate in the elections was going on at the office. After completion, the voter list was finalized on Thursday. This time a list of 2027 entrepreneurs has been prepared for voting, which is a record vote in itself.
These voters will form the new executive for 2026-27. Distribution of forms to participate in the election process has started. The form costs Rs 200 per person, while to get the voter list, Rs 500 will have to be deposited at the office. He told that the last time in the year 2011, NEA elections were decided through a competition between two panels.
After this, without any other panel coming in the election, Vipin Kumar Malhan and VK Seth panel were elected unopposed but the election process was conducted in a completely democratic manner. This time too, after the announcement of elections, the election process will be conducted after the arrival of the second panel.
Let us tell you that this time the biggest election panel is going to be included. There will be an executive committee of 24 entrepreneur candidates, while the EC members will be around 142. This means that this will be the first organization in NCR whose executive body will be so big.
About 44 members are being included more in the election process because in 2023-24, a panel of 132 people along with 18 executive members had contested the election, but no other panel came against this panel.
